Step-by-Step Instructions for Preparation

Now that you have your ingredients ready, it’s time to dive into the cooking process. Follow these step-by-step instructions to create your Creamy Garlic Chicken & Spinach:

Preparing the Chicken: Seasoning and Cooking Tips

1. Season the Chicken: Start by patting the boneless, skinless chicken breasts dry with paper towels. This will help achieve a nice sear. Season both sides generously with salt and black pepper. If you have time, let the seasoned chicken sit at room temperature for about 15 minutes to enhance the flavor.

2. Cook the Chicken: In a large skillet over medium heat, add a tablespoon of olive oil or butter. Once the oil is hot, carefully place the seasoned chicken breasts in the skillet. Cook for 5-7 minutes on each side, or until the chicken is golden brown and cooked through (the internal temperature should reach 165°F). Once cooked, remove the chicken from the skillet and set it aside to rest.

Sautéing Garlic for Optimal Flavor Infusion

3. Sauté the Garlic: In the same skillet, add an additional drizzle of oil or a small pat of butter if needed. Lower the heat slightly, then add the minced garlic to the skillet. Sauté for about 30 seconds to 1 minute, stirring frequently, until the garlic is fragrant and lightly golden. Be cautious not to burn the garlic, as it can develop a bitter flavor.

The Importance of Deglazing the Skillet

4. Deglaze the Skillet: After sautéing the garlic, it’s time to deglaze the skillet. Pour in about 1 cup of chicken broth, scraping the bottom of the skillet with a wooden spoon to release any flavorful bits stuck to the pan. This step is crucial as it adds depth to your sauce. Allow the broth to simmer for a couple of minutes to reduce slightly and concentrate the flavors.

Creating the Creamy Sauce: Blending Broth, Cream, and Seasoning

5. Create the Creamy Sauce: Once the broth has reduced, lower the heat and stir in 1 cup of heavy cream. Mix well and bring the sauce to a gentle simmer. Add in the Italian seasoning and any additional salt and pepper to taste. If you’re using grated cheese, stir it in at this stage, allowing it to melt and incorporate into the sauce, creating a rich and creamy consistency.

6. Combine Spinach and Chicken: Finally, add the fresh spinach to the sauce, allowing it to wilt for a minute or two. Return the cooked chicken to the skillet, spooning the creamy sauce over the top. Allow everything to heat through for an additional few minutes, ensuring the chicken is warmed and the flavors meld beautifully.

Incorporating Fresh Spinach: Cooking Methods and Timing

Fresh spinach is a star ingredient in Creamy Garlic Chicken, providing not only vibrant color but also a wealth of nutrients. To incorporate spinach effectively without compromising its texture or nutritional value, follow these tips:

1. Timing is Key: Add the spinach to the pan towards the end of the cooking process. Spinach wilts quickly, usually within 2 to 3 minutes. This brief cooking time preserves its bright green color and ensures that it retains its essential vitamins.

2. Sautéing: In the final stages of cooking, after the chicken has been cooked through and removed from the pan, toss in the fresh spinach. Stir it gently into the creamy garlic sauce until it just starts to wilt. This method enhances the flavor profile while ensuring that the spinach remains fresh and vibrant.

3. Layering: If you prefer a more pronounced spinach flavor, you can layer it in the dish. Add half of the spinach in the last few minutes of cooking and reserve the rest to fold in just before serving. This technique creates a beautiful contrast between the wilted and fresh spinach, adding both texture and visual appeal.

Bringing It All Together: Reheating Chicken in the Sauce

Once the spinach has been added, it’s time to bring the dish together. Reheating the chicken in the creamy garlic sauce ensures it absorbs all those delicious flavors. Here’s how to do it:

1. Combine and Heat: Place the chicken back into the pan with the creamy garlic sauce and spinach. Ensure the chicken is evenly coated with the sauce.

2. Simmer Gently: Allow the chicken to simmer in the sauce on low heat for about 5 minutes. This gentle reheating allows the chicken to warm through while soaking up the garlicky goodness of the sauce. It also helps meld the flavors together, creating a rich and cohesive dish.

3. Final Adjustments: Taste the sauce and adjust the seasoning if necessary. A pinch of salt, a dash of pepper, or a squeeze of lemon can elevate the dish even further.

Variations and Customizations

One of the joys of cooking is the ability to customize recipes to suit your tastes or dietary preferences. Here are some creative twists you can try with Creamy Garlic Chicken & Spinach:

Substituting Proteins: If you’re looking to switch up the protein, consider alternatives like turkey or shrimp. Both options can easily replace chicken in this recipe while providing a delicious twist.

Vegetarian Options: For a vegetarian version, swap out chicken for tofu or chickpeas. Tofu can be sautéed to achieve a golden crust and absorb the flavors of the sauce, while chickpeas add a hearty texture and protein.

Adjusting Creaminess: If you’re looking to reduce calories or fat, you can use low-fat cream or dairy-free alternatives such as coconut cream or cashew cream. These options maintain a creamy texture while catering to different dietary needs.

Experimenting with Herbs and Spices: To add unique flavors, try incorporating different herbs and spices. Fresh thyme or oregano can enhance the dish, while a pinch of smoked paprika can add a subtle smokiness that complements the garlic.

Ingredients
  

2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ts

2 cups fresh spinach

4 cloves garlic, minced

1 cup heavy cream

1 cup chicken broth

1 tablespoon olive oil

1 teaspoon Italian seasoning

Salt and pepper to taste

1 cup grated Parmesan cheese

Cooked pasta or rice (for serving)

Instructions
 

In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Season the chicken breasts with salt and pepper, then add them to the skillet. Cook for 6-7 minutes on each side, until thoroughly cooked and golden. Remove from the skillet and set aside.

    In the same skillet, add the minced garlic and sauté for about 1 minute, until fragrant.

      Pour in the chicken broth, scraping the bottom of the skillet to deglaze.

        Stir in the heavy cream and Italian seasoning, bringing the mixture to a gentle simmer.

          Add the grated Parmesan cheese, stirring until melted and combined.

            Add the fresh spinach to the skillet and cook until wilted, about 2-3 minutes.

              Return the chicken to the skillet, simmering for an additional 3-4 minutes to heat through.

                Serve the creamy garlic sauce over cooked pasta or rice.

                  Prep Time: 10 min | Total Time: 30 min | Servings: 2 servings
